hula hoop

noun
/ˈhuːlə ˌhuːp/

Etymology

Coined by Australian model Joan Anderson. Former trademark of Wham-O, which introduced the product in 1958.

Definitions

  1. A toy in the form of a large hoop which is twirled around various parts of the body,…

    A toy in the form of a large hoop which is twirled around various parts of the body, especially the waist.

  2. To use a hula hoop.
